The key intermediaries in most non-cash purchases today are the oligopolistic charge card firms (Visa has around 60% of the credit history and debit card market, MasterCard has 25%, American Express 13%, and Discover 2%). Mobile apps such as Apple Pay, Venmo, and Square are also gaining a foothold. However, despite who plays that duty, Congress has curved to the will of the monetary industry and rejected to enact adequate personal privacy securities.
